A massive sculpture of the Earth itself forms a dramatic centrepiece.
The Atrium consists of six sculpture display units which consist of glass base plinths, minerals, graphics, interactive monitors and a twenty foot high sculptured figure. The themes are based on the astronaut, science and the arts.

The elscalator takes the visitor through the middle of the 100 foot sphere, which is suspended in the main void of the atrium. Oxidised, beaten metal panels are riveted onto a framework and the whole unit slowly rotates. The lighting and projection creatures textures and movement to recreate an abstract version of the earths core and shifting magna plates.
